imbrue

English

Alternative forms

* embrue

Verb

  • To stain (in, with, blood, slaughter, etc.).
  • * 1837 : Edward Smallwood, Manuella, the Executioner’s Daughter?;?A Story of Madrid , volume II, pages 275–276] ([[w:Bentley's Miscellany, Richard Bentley])
  • Armed with the weapon which was destined to destroy himself, Imnaz sprang down the ladder,?—?found the door, and, emerging from the abode of crime, sought a more secure resting place, leaving his hostess to discover, with return of day, in whose blood were imbrued the hands of an hospiticide.
